Output e02664e3ec5597d6126aa0c6026a45cfeae270dc6e2e92d959e81f5eca771636:5

value
3821591
script pubkey
OP_0 OP_PUSHBYTES_20 148f18794a34bfa78ef7b8a6785de2709e211917
address
bc1qzj83s722xjl60rhhhzn8sh0zwz0zzxghcja2y4
transaction
e02664e3ec5597d6126aa0c6026a45cfeae270dc6e2e92d959e81f5eca771636
spent
true